What's Involved

Siding installation follows a set sequence. We break work into phases so you can plan around noise, access, and site conditions.

1

Inspection & Estimate

We walk your home, check existing damage, measure square footage, and explain material options. We clarify permit requirements for Bristol homes.

2

Material Selection

Choose vinyl siding or composite siding based on durability, appearance, and maintenance preferences. We recommend options that handle Connecticut humidity.

3

Permit & Planning

We obtain zoning permits through Bristol's Building Department. Homeowners associations in Forestville or Edgewood may have specific requirements we handle.

4

Prep & Demo

We remove old siding safely, inspect and repair underlying sheathing, and install house wrap and flashing to prevent water damage.

5

Installation

Our crew installs siding panel by panel, ensuring proper nailing, expansion gaps, and corner trim. Every joint is sealed to keep water out.

6

Final Walkthrough

We do a detailed inspection with you, clean the job site, remove all debris, and make sure everything is built to code and your satisfaction.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need a permit for new siding in Bristol?

Yes, the Bristol Building Department requires a zoning permit and building permit for siding installation. We handle the application and coordination with the Zoning Enforcement Office.

What material lasts longer in Connecticut weather?

Vinyl and composite both perform well if installed correctly with proper flashing and ventilation. Composite requires no painting; vinyl is more affordable and easier to repair individual panels.

Can I do a partial siding replacement or do I need the whole house done?

Partial replacement works for isolated damage. Full replacement is often more cost-effective and ensures color consistency, but we'll assess and recommend what fits your budget and home.
